René Springer (born 15 July 1979) is a German politician. Born in Berlin, he represents Alternative for Germany (AfD). René Springer has served as a member of the Bundestag from the state of Brandenburg since 2017.
In January 2024, He spoke in favor of Remigration, by writing on X, “We will return foreigners to their homeland. Millions of times. This is not a secret plan. It’s a promise.
“For more security. For more justice. To preserve our identity. For Germany.”[1]
Life
He became member of the bundestag after the 2017 German federal election.[2] He is a member of the Committee for Labour and Social Affairs.[3]
